An Excellent Pedal!
Posted by Dan Cuffe from Salem, OR on Sep 21, 2008
Experience w/product: I have heard about it
Reviewer's Background: Basement rocker, jamming with friends
Reviewer's Play Style: Hard rock, stoner rock, doom metal
This pedal was exactly what I was looking for. I will discuss it's high points, and low points.

First the bad: This pedal is made of plastic, and I'm a stomper. I wouldn't feel at ease hammerin' down the fuzz in the middle of a song, so I'd be more likely to come at it a little easier, but that isn't a huge problem. I felt the plastic guard on the knobs made it too hard to mess with the controls, so I took it off. The biggest problem was this: For anything heavier than "hard rock," I would not use the octave feature. It makes it sound kind of robotic and noisy if you put too much fuzz with the octave, which may be what you're looking for, but it's a bit extreme for just plain riffin'. Also, it's pretty noisy on its own. Let me explain, whilst playing, it is great, no unwanted sound, but when you stop, after almost an exact second, you get that mellow hum, similar to when your guitar isn't plugged in and your amp is on. No big deal, just stomp the pedal off.

Now the good: I was able to get an enormous range of fuzzez. I could get any sound I wanted, exactly how I want it. This is really a true modern fuzz sound. You won't be able to exactly recreate the sounds of old but you can get fairly close, or come up with YOUR sound, which is really what music is about! Also, my complaint with fuzz pedals before this was that I couldn't get enough, but this pedal has more than enough for me.

Overall, excellent pedal!

pocket monster
Posted by XFREE from Philippines on Aug 28, 2008
Experience w/product: I have heard about it
Reviewer's Background: active church musician
Reviewer's Play Style: blues, rock, christian rock
Perfomance of this pedal will soley rely on how good your amp is. If you have a cheap chinese solidstate generic amp and it will sounds like a swarm of beez. I have tried it also on my 10watts IBANEZ practice amp but considering the size of the amp it sounded great. Gives a slightly compressed tones and good mids for lead. I can dial in a wide variety of drive sounds, from Overdrive to Distortion to Fuzz just by varying the EQ knob. Dial in the distortion knob for more sustain and crack up the level for more punchy attacks. Octave sound is an alternative experimental pshychaedelic tone, good for power chords and, sounds haunting/devlish when used for leads.

Minimal tone loss when bypassed, unnoticeable, doesn't hum on ac/dc walwart adaptor. And Battery life is very good as it uses 2mA only as I tested/tap it out on a multi-meter.

One thing I dislike about this pedal is its' tiny knobs. How I wish I could rehouse this and make the knobs play in a wider-manner and also make the octave switch a real stomp footswitch instead. Nonetheless I would leave it as it is designed, atleast It easily fits in my pocket, on a call for quicky-gig.

Overall think of this like a tubescreamer with a lot of gain, I dubbed it as a pocket monster.
